La. Rev. Stat. § 23:983 Freedom of choice
0.3K chars
§983. Freedom of choice No person shall be required, as a condition of employment, to become or remain a member of any labor organization, or to pay any dues, fees, assessments, or other charges of any kind to a labor organization. Added by Acts 1976, No. 97, §1.

La. Rev. Stat. § 23:994 Private remedy
0.2K chars
§994. Private remedy No provision of this Part shall be construed to be a bar to any civil action by a private party against any person for the violation of R.S. 23:992. Added by Acts 1979, No. 534, §1.
